Biomass is commonly defined as renewable organic material derived from living matter (both plants and animals) excluding fossil fuel. Examples include agricultural residue (such as rice straw and sugar cane residue), food waste and animal waste. Recycling and smart use of biomass, in particular waste generated during primary production has particular economic value, such as power, construction, fertilizer etc fields.
